For future reference (that I hope won't be needed by anyone) I would have suggested a call to the doc who ordered the ‘roids to get a script called or e-scripted to the pharmacy. "The Sooner The Better" would seem to be a good mantra when dealing with oral candida.
The Tysabri probably has you immunosuppressed enough that the add-on steroids took you over the trush edge. It does usually present as a white coating on the lips, tongue, gum and/or cheeks but removing that coating (like during oral hygiene) leaves areas that are red, raw, tender (to downright painful) and capable of bleeding.
FYI on the S&S (Swish & Swallow):
Do the treatment after meals. Clean your mouth first and **remove dentures or other removable dental appliances** during each treatment so the medicine can reach every spot it needs to. Swish as completely as you can for as long as you can before swallowing.
In fact, it's a good idea to split the dose and S&S twice to get the best coating of medicine on all your oral membranes. (Does that make it a S&S&S - Split & Swish & Spit? lol) Seriously, this gives the medicine a better opportunity to adhere to tissues as you swallow smaller amounts. (This stuff can decide to take an excursion down the pike.)
You can even get one of those kiddie dosing syringes (or get a regular one - sans needle - from your doctor) to draw up your dose. Carefully squirt (but don’t splash) a bit directly on the worst areas - then swish and swish and swish, then swallow. (I guess the “S” game could go on forever!)
As always, FINISH THE ENTIRE PRESCRIBED COURSE unless your doc directs you otherwise along the way. You don't want this bad boy to take a detour or make a round trip.
Make sure you read the prescription directions. Every once in a while a doc might prescribe a Swish & SPIT. The only thing I can add to that (beside noting yet another S-word) is to have a disposable drool & drip catcher handy!
If you really can't tolerate the S&S there is a troche you suck on (stars=you let it melt in your mouth). I never tried one. I'm guessing it doesn't taste like a LifeSaver.
Add on hints:
Keep your mouth clean but avoid "germ killing" mouthwashes. Yes, even after this clears. They clean out more than is necessary or good. Right now they can delay the return to a normal F&F balance (less flora & healthier fauna). Besides, the alcohol in most will hurt like you know what.
Limit the amount of sugar and yeast containing foods you eat (and drink - sorry about the beer implications). Fungi thrive on these 'nutrients'.
Lulu, if you take high dose steroids again in the future (especially while taking Tysabri) there's a good chance you will need the S&S again. It might not hurt to have a script on file 'just in case".

I use something called "GSE" (grapefruit seed extract). you can buy it at the health food store. Put about 10 drops into a glass of water and then rinse your mouth and spit it out. It tastes awful, very bitter, but it is an all natural remedy. I also take probiotics. If you are getting vaginal thrush (ick) you can also insert a capsule (they are gel caps) at bedtime for a few days to try and balance things out. Keep in mind this is a supplement, not a treatment so is better at the first symptoms, and not to treat a full on infection.

If your taste is altered you may have thrush. That is a key sign. Yes steroids can cause it . Anyone with asthma and who uses advair the powdered steroid knows about thrush. I gargle with salt water myself when ever I am on steroids. Anytime your immune system is down you can get it as well. I got mine when I was on antibiotics and advair. I switched inhalers since advair is prone to it.
